Procedural Posture

Matrimonial Property Cause / Interlocutory Application for Temporary Injunction

  1. 1 Whether the Plaintiff is entitled to a temporary injunction restraining the Defendant from disposing of or interfering with the suit properties pending determination of the main suit.
  2. 2 Whether the suit properties constitute matrimonial property acquired during the subsistence of the marriage.
  3. 3 Whether the Plaintiff has demonstrated a prima facie case warranting preservation of the properties.

Ratio Decidendi

The court found that the dispute centers on the preservation of properties claimed as matrimonial property in a polygamous family setting. Given the acknowledgment by the Defendant that some parcels were acquired during the marriage and the Plaintiff's claim of contribution, the court determined that a prima facie case for preservation was established. The court held that granting a temporary injunction to restrain the Defendant from disposing of the properties was necessary to prevent further escalation of the dispute and to preserve the subject matter pending the determination of the main suit. Court Disposition

Plaintiff's application for temporary injunction allowed in part; Defendant restrained from disposing of specified properties pending suit determination.

Orders

  • The Defendant is hereby restrained from selling, transferring or otherwise disposing of, during the pendency of this suit or until further order of the court, the following properties: LR LOC 19/GACHARAGEINI/[...], LR LOC 19/GACHARAGEINI/[...], LR LOC 19/GACHARAGEINI/[...].
  • Costs of the application shall be in the cause.
